Transaction 058f3329afe387c18d56c0b7822f81c202160227b4fd29bc4fe6eb5e32783feb

1 Input
2 Outputs
  • 058f3329afe387c18d56c0b7822f81c202160227b4fd29bc4fe6eb5e32783feb:0
  • value  181368
    address  32ujzbsSPicDzp6qyR4HSw7cY9L17cBsdx
  • 058f3329afe387c18d56c0b7822f81c202160227b4fd29bc4fe6eb5e32783feb:1
  • value  36388127
    address  376tWmMnZEYUZemSTcLR1iNgtZzXeE4RoG